Griggsville, Il vs Abu Hamed Climate & Distance Between

Sudan flag
  • The distance between Griggsville, Il, Usa and Abu Hamed, Sudan is approximately 11,240 km or 6,985 mi.
  • To reach Griggsville, Il in this distance one would set out from Abu Hamed bearing 319.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Griggsville, Il bearing 232.7° or SW .
  • Griggsville,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Abu Hamed has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Griggsville,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Abu Hamed is in or near the tropical desert biome.
  • The mean temperature is 18.2 °C (32.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 14 °C (25.2°F) more in Griggsville,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 966.6 mm (38.1 in) more which is equivalent to 966.6 l/m² (23.72 US gal/ft²) or 9,666,000 l/ha (1,033,360 US gal/ac) more. About 77 5/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.1° lower in Griggsville, Il than in Abu Hamed.
